This is a build for the 'Lands of Classic-Castle' storyline over in the rpg forum. My character has hitched a lift on a waggon to the Royal Castle.

For the Royal Guards I was inspired by the 'Swiss Guard' that protect the Pope in the Vatican. They look ridiculous, but you still get the feeling that if you crossed them they would kick your backside into next week. The colours and faces were also chosen to reflect the 'classic' part of castle.
